    I found an even simpler recipe for the KLC than the one linked here. Instead of 2 cake mixes and pudding, it's done with a single brownie mix and sour cream whipped icing. I imagine cream cheese icing would work just fine too. It makes a smaller litter pan's worth and feeds fewer people than the more commonly used recipe, and of course still uses the crumbled cookies (and green coloring) and tootsie (poopie) rolls too. My granddaughter's 21st birthday is in a few weeks - think I'll try out the brownie KLC on her before I do it for my niece in September.
